Comment on: RustDesk now supports true unattended remote access on Wayland
To establish a connection between client and remote host, you are expected to go through a coordination server which you trust, that can be either the official one or your own self-hosted instance. Your client and the remote host will then attempt to directly connect if possible, only actually sending the display and input streams through a relay server if a direct connection is impossible due to NAT or whatever else.The use case where encryption is not supported is directly connecting by IP address, which is not the intended use for this software.
